#43d531 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#43d531 is composed of 26.3% red, 83.5% green and 19.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 68.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 77% yellow and 16.5% black. It has a hue angle of 113.4 degrees, a saturation of 66.1% and a lightness of 51.4%. #43d531 color hex could be obtained by blending #86ff62 with #00ab00. Closest websafe color is: #33cc33.

Shades and Tints of #43d531

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020601 is the darkest color, while #f5fdf5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#43d531

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7f897d is the less saturated color, while #25fb0b is the most saturated one.
